September 2024 Community of Interest Highlights

The Aging in Community Education & Research (ACER) Community of Interest serves as a platform for sharing emerging trends, exchanging knowledge, and exploring research opportunities in an informal and relaxed setting. It enables organizations, as well as individuals such as faculty, researchers, and students, to connect and collaborate effectively.


The highlights from our recent CI gathering on Thursday, September 19th, 2024, are as follows:

Doris Hanlon, Managing Director, ADM Access, gave a presentation about accessibility options, including automated options, to enable older adults to age safely in their own homes. In addition, Doris shared a variety of potential funding resources available to support these home enhancements. 


There was a robust conversation about funding resources that led to a discussion about the potential of creating a resource document for older adults and their families that describes the resources that tend to stay stable over time. As many people are unaware of possible financial support, the ACER team will follow up with Doris about the possibility of developing a resource.
